Venus' atmosphere is 90 times thicker than Earth's, and it's closer to the Sun, so it's more likely to get blown away. Venus is also slightly smaller than Earth. Definately the mass of a planet has a lot of say in how much of an atmosphere a planet has, but it's clear that gravity alone isn't the whole o the equation. |
Venus' atmosphere is composed of heavier gases, like sulfer compounds, many of which wouldn't be gasified if the surface and atmospheric temperatures weren't so high. I believe that its closer proximity to the sun allowed the heavier compounds to be formed and gasified, trapping heat, which led to even heavier compounds being liberated into the atmosphere, and so on until an equilibrium was reached. The thickness of the atmosphere then would be a factor of the planet's size and its surface and atmospheric temperatures. I don't see how closeness to the sun would cause atmospheric gas to be blown away. It might cause lighter gases to literally diffuse away?

Difficult to say, if it should be terraformed.
As a Biologist I would like it to first be fully explored for fossils of lifeforms (for example bacteriae).
Due to the close proximity of the habitability zones of mars to earth and the former presence of water on the planet, it could be interesting to conduct extensive surveys.
There is also the mysterie of those possible Bacteria fossils in ALH 94001 where it AFAIK up to date couldn´t be definitely proven or disproven if the residues are remnants from Mars-microbae.
So I would chose to first conduct extensive biological research on Mars before making a decision wehter terraform Mars or not (I fearexisting fossils could be destroyed if as a result of terraforming the climate gets more humid and the atmospheric pressure rises).

Sun's rays to roast Earth as poles flip
Robin McKie, science editor
Sunday November 10, 2002
The Observer
Earth's magnetic field - the force that protects us from deadly radiation bursts from outer space - is weakening dramatically.
Scientists have discovered that its strength has dropped precipitously over the past two centuries and could disappear over the next 1,000 years.
The effects could be catastrophic. Powerful radiation bursts, which normally never touch the atmosphere, would heat up its upper layers, triggering climatic disruption. Navigation and communication satellites, Earth's eyes and ears, would be destroyed and migrating animals left unable to navigate.
'Earth's magnetic field has disappeared many times before - as a prelude to our magnetic poles flipping over, when north becomes south and vice versa,' said Dr Alan Thomson of the British Geological Survey in Edinburgh.
'Reversals happen every 250,000 years or so, and as there has not been one for almost a million years, we are due one soon.'
For more than 100 years, scientists have noted the strength of Earth's magnetic field has been declining, but have disagreed about interpretations. Some said its drop was a precursor to reversal, others argued it merely indicated some temporary variation in field strength has been occurring.
But now Gauthier Hulot of the Paris Geophysical Institute has discovered Earth's magnetic field seems to be disappearing most alarmingly near the poles, a clear sign that a flip may soon take place.
Using satellite measurements of field variations over the past 20 years, Hulot plotted the currents of molten iron that generate Earth's magnetism deep underground and spotted huge whorls near the poles.
Hulot believes these vortices rotate in a direction that reinforces a reverse magnetic field, and as they grow and proliferate these eddies will weaken the dominant field: the first steps toward a new polarity, he says.
And as Scientific American reports this week, this interpretation has now been backed up by computer simulation studies.
How long a reversal might last is a matter of scientific controversy, however. Records of past events, embedded in iron minerals in ancient lava beds, show some can last for thousands of years - during which time the planet will have been exposed to batterings from solar radiation. On the other hand, other researchers say some flips may have lasted only a few weeks.
Exactly what will happen when Earth's magnetic field disappears prior to its re-emergence in a reversed orientation is also difficult to assess. Compasses would point to the wrong pole - a minor inconvenience. More importantly, low-orbiting satellites would be exposed to electromagnetic batterings, wrecking them.
In addition, many species of migrating animals and birds - from swallows to wildebeests - rely on innate abilities to track Earth's magnetic field. Their fates are impossible to gauge.
As to humans, our greatest risk would come from intense solar radiation bursts. Normally these are contained by the planet's magnetic field in space. However, if it disappears, particle storms will start to batter the atmosphere.
'These solar particles can have profound effects,' said Dr Paul Murdin, of the Institute of Astronomy, Cambridge. 'On Mars, when its magnetic field failed permanently billions of years ago, it led to its atmosphere being boiled off. On Earth, it will heat up the upper atmosphere and send ripples round the world with enormous, unpredictable effects on the climate.'

AP Falsely Reports Mars Radiation Data
March 14, 2003
The Associated Press yesterday issued a wire article claiming that "the radiation on the surface of Mars is so intense that it could endanger astronauts sent to explore the Red Planet." The AP claimed that these were the findings of the MARIE instrument currently operating on the Mars Odyssey spacecraft, and ascribed the view that such radiation doses were too high to allow human explorers to Dr. Cary Zeitlin of the National Space Biomedical Institute in Houston. Dr. Zeitlin is the Principal Investigator for the MARIE radiation detection instrument.
In fact, however, the MARIE data, which is publicly available at the MARIE website at marie.jsc.nasa.gov/Results.html, show exactly the opposite. Currently posted data for January 2003 show radiation levels in low Mars orbit of 25 millirads/day, or 9 rads/year. While this level is slightly less than twice the regulatory dose for persons employed in the nuclear industry, it represents no significant threat. According the conservative "linear hypothesis" for dealing with low doses accepted in the radiation health physics community, a dose of 13 rads delivered over a 1.5 year Mars mission surface stay would represent a statistical increase in likelihood of cancer (at some point later in life) of about one quarter of one percent. In contrast, the average American smoker receives a 20 percent increase in cancer risk. The Mars radiation risk is thus only about 1/100th as dangerous as smoking.
The MARIE radiation measurements were taken in Mars orbit. Doses on the surface would be even lower.
Thus far from proving that radiation is a showstopper for human Mars missions, the MARIE data show that radiation is NOT a major obstacle to human exploration.
